Synthetic Route to 2-Deoxyaldoses by Fluoride-Catalyzed Solvolysis of Enol-Phosphate Esters

1-Alkenyl and phenyl phosphate esters undergo smooth cleavage of the phosphorous-oxygen linkage by fluoride-catalyzed alcoholysis to give aldehydes (ketones) and phenols, respectively.Application of this method provides a new route to 2-deoxyaldosugars from the enol-phosphates derived from vinylene carbonate telomers.Keywords -- vinylene carbonate telomer; 2-deoxyaldose; enol phosphate; cesium fluoride; aryl phosphate
